March 26, 2005

HAMPTON, VA  -The Old Dominion sailing team is currently fifth out of 11 teams after the first day of the MAISA-SAISA regatta, held at Hampton University, with 89 points. Michael Collins (Bayport, NY) and Tyler Obara (Yorktown, VA) are fourth in A division with 44 points, while Brian McEwing (Cape May, NJ) and Amanda Martin are fifth in B division with 45 points. Georgetown currently leads the regatta with 26 points.
